Unlocking the Mystery: Explore the Pinlock System for Helmets!

Welcome adventurers! Have you ever wondered what keeps your helmet visor fog-free, ensuring crystal-clear vision during those exhilarating rides? Enter the Pinlock system, a fascinating marvel that remains a mystery to many riders. In this article, we will shed light on this ingenious invention, taking you on a journey to explore how it works, its benefits, and everything else you need to know about this nifty innovation. So buckle up and get ready to unlock the secret behind the Pinlock system, as we dive into its inner workings and uncover its magic. Let’s hit the road!
1. What is the Pinlock System and How Does it Work?

The Pinlock system is a revolutionary innovation in helmet visor technology that ensures a fog-free riding experience. It consists of two essential components: the Pinlock-ready visor and the Pinlock insert. The Pinlock-ready visor has specially designed pins built into it, while the Pinlock insert is a transparent sheet with a silicon seal. When combined, they create an airtight double-layered system that prevents fogging up of the visor.

So how does it work? The Pinlock insert is positioned between the two pins on the visor, and the silicon seal ensures a tight fit. This creates a thin layer of air that acts as an insulator, preventing moisture from condensing on the visor. The double-layered system works by constantly equalizing the temperature and humidity inside the helmet, reducing the chances of fogging even in the most challenging weather conditions. Whether you’re riding in cold, wet, or humid environments, the Pinlock system keeps your visor crystal clear, ensuring optimum visibility and safety on the road.

Advantages of the Pinlock system:
– Fog-free vision: Ensure a clear view of the road ahead, minimizing distractions and promoting safer riding.
– Versatility: Compatible with various helmet brands and models, providing a convenient, universal solution.
– Easy installation: The Pinlock insert can be easily installed without the need for any tools, making it effortless to switch between clear and tinted visors.
– Low maintenance: The Pinlock insert can be cleaned quickly and effortlessly, offering a hassle-free maintenance experience.
– Cost-effective: Investing in a Pinlock system is more economical than continuously purchasing anti-fog sprays or wipes.

Experience the ultimate fog-free riding pleasure with the Pinlock system, where safety and clarity meet innovation. Whether you’re a daily commuter, an enthusiastic weekend rider, or an adventure seeker, the Pinlock system ensures that your vision remains unobstructed, enabling you to focus on the thrill of the ride.

2. The Benefits of Using Pinlock Technology for Helmet Visibility

Pinlock technology is a game-changer when it comes to improving helmet visibility. This innovative system consists of a specially designed insert that works to prevent fogging, ensuring clear and unobstructed vision for riders. Here are some key benefits of using Pinlock technology:

  • No More Fogging: One of the biggest advantages of Pinlock technology is its ability to combat fogging. With the Pinlock insert attached to your helmet, you can say goodbye to foggy visors that obstruct your view and compromise your safety.
  • Enhanced Safety: Clear visibility is crucial for a rider’s safety on the road. By using Pinlock technology, you ensure that your vision remains unobstructed, allowing you to fully concentrate on the road ahead. This can help you anticipate potential hazards and react quickly and effectively.
  • Year-round Comfort: Pinlock inserts are not only effective in preventing fogging but also help regulate temperature inside the helmet. This means that you can ride comfortably in various weather conditions without worrying about fogged-up visors or excessive heat build-up.

Investing in a helmet with Pinlock technology is a smart choice for any rider who values safety and clear visibility. With the advantage of no more fogging, enhanced safety, and year-round comfort, Pinlock technology takes helmet visibility to a whole new level.

3. A Step-by-Step Guide to Installing and Adjusting the Pinlock System

Installing and adjusting the Pinlock system on your helmet is a straightforward process that can enhance your riding experience. To guide you through each step, we have put together this easy-to-follow tutorial:

Step 1: Choosing the Right Pinlock Insert

  • Measure the size of the Pinlock-ready visor on your helmet.
  • Refer to the Pinlock manufacturer’s sizing guide to find the appropriate insert.
  • Ensure the insert matches the measurements to ensure a proper fit.

Step 2: Preparing the Pinlock Insert

  • Clean the visor thoroughly to remove any debris or finger oils.
  • Peel off the protective film from both sides of the Pinlock insert.
  • Gently align the insert onto the visor, ensuring it fits snugly.

These first two steps ensure that you are ready to proceed with the final adjustments to secure the Pinlock system in your helmet. By properly installing and adjusting the Pinlock system, you can prevent fogging and maintain clear vision during your rides.

4. Exploring the Different Pinlock Options for Various Helmet Brands

When it comes to choosing a helmet for motorcycle riding, safety is of utmost importance. One crucial aspect to consider is the visor, which should provide clear vision under any weather conditions. That’s where Pinlock options come in! Pinlock is a fog-resistant insert that fits inside the visor, preventing fog from obstructing your view.

Pinlock offers a range of different options suitable for various helmet brands. Whether you own a popular brand like Shoei, Arai, or AGV or prefer lesser-known ones, there’s a Pinlock solution for you. These inserts come in different sizes and shapes to accommodate the visor shape of the specific helmet brand. With Pinlock, you can confidently ride in any climate, knowing that your visor will remain fog-free, allowing you to focus solely on the road ahead. It’s a must-have accessory for every helmet user!

  • Wide compatibility: Pinlock options are designed to fit a wide range of helmet brands, including both major and niche ones.
  • Easy installation: Installing a Pinlock insert is a breeze, even for those who are not technically inclined. Simply attach it to the appropriate pins inside the visor, and you’re good to go!
  • Anti-fog technology: Pinlock inserts are created using advanced anti-fog technology, ensuring clear vision at all times, regardless of the weather conditions. Say goodbye to foggy visors!
  • Comfortable and durable: Pinlock options are made from high-quality materials, providing a comfortable and long-lasting solution that will serve you well throughout countless rides.

So, whether you’re riding on a chilly morning or through a humid rainstorm, Pinlock has got your back. Browse the Pinlock options for your helmet brand and never let fog get in the way of your ride again!

5. Common Questions and Answers about the Pinlock System

Here, we have compiled some common questions and answers regarding the Pinlock system that may help address any doubts or concerns you might have:

How does the Pinlock system work?

The Pinlock system is an innovative anti-fogging solution for helmet visors. It consists of a clear silicone seal that is attached to the inside of the visor by small pins. When inserted, the Pinlock creates a double-layered visor system, creating an airtight chamber between the Pinlock insert and the visor. This chamber acts as a barrier, preventing fogging by regulating temperature, thereby ensuring clear visibility even in changing weather conditions.

Can the Pinlock insert be used with any helmet?

Yes, the Pinlock system is designed to be compatible with a wide range of helmet brands and models. Most helmets feature a Pinlock-ready visor, allowing for easy installation of the Pinlock insert. However, it is always recommended to check if your helmet is Pinlock compatible before making a purchase. Additionally, Pinlock inserts come in various sizes to accommodate different visors, so be sure to choose the correct size for your helmet to ensure the best fit and performance.

6. Enhancing Safety and Comfort: Pinlock vs. Foggy Mask

If you’re an avid rider, safety and comfort are likely your top priorities. Two popular options to enhance your riding experience are the Pinlock and Foggy Mask. Both serve the purpose of preventing fog buildup on your visor during your journey, but they do so in different ways.


  • The Pinlock is a revolutionary system that ensures clear visibility by creating a double-pane shield between your face and the visor.
  • This antifog insert, made from a moisture-absorbing material, is easily installed by attaching it to the preexisting pins on the inside of your visor.
  • Pinlock’s advantage lies in its ability to provide a consistent, fog-free field of view, regardless of external weather conditions.

Foggy Mask:

  • If you prefer a more traditional approach, the Foggy Mask might be the perfect fit for you.
  • This neoprene mask is specifically designed to cover the nose area, preventing breath from reaching the visor and causing fogging.
  • Easily adjustable and comfortable to wear, the Foggy Mask offers a reliable and efficient solution to combat fog buildup, particularly in colder climates.

Ultimately, the choice between Pinlock and Foggy Mask boils down to personal preference. Both options are effective in enhancing safety and comfort by eliminating fog-induced distractions during your ride. Consider your riding conditions, climate, and personal comfort when making this decision, and enjoy a hassle-free journey!

7. Pinlock System Maintenance: Tips for Optimal Performance

Proper maintenance of your Pinlock system is crucial to ensuring optimal performance and extending its longevity. Here are some useful tips to help you keep your Pinlock system in top shape:

  • Regular cleaning: Clean the Pinlock lens and pins regularly using a mild soap solution and warm water. Avoid using harsh chemical cleaners as they may damage the lens or pins.
  • Avoid excessive force: When inserting or removing the Pinlock lens, be gentle and avoid applying excessive force to prevent any damage to the pins or lens.
  • Inspect for damage: Regularly inspect the Pinlock lens and pins for any signs of wear or damage. If you notice any cracks, scratches, or loose pins, it’s advisable to replace them to ensure proper functionality.

Additionally, it is important to store your Pinlock lens in a dry and safe place when not in use to prevent any accidental damage. Following these maintenance tips will help ensure your Pinlock system continues to provide you with clear vision and excellent fog resistance for a prolonged period.

8. Future Innovations: What’s in Store for the Pinlock System?

As the Pinlock system continues to revolutionize the industry, there are some exciting future innovations on the horizon that are set to take this technology to the next level. Here are a few noteworthy advancements we can look forward to:

  • Smart Integration: Imagine a Pinlock visor that can seamlessly connect to your smartphone. With smart integration, you’ll be able to receive notifications, track your rides, and even control navigation, all without taking your eyes off the road.
  • Enhanced Visibility: Safety is always a top priority, and future advancements in the Pinlock system are dedicated to improving visibility even further. Get ready for anti-glare coatings that reduce distractions from bright headlights, and enhanced clarity that ensures crystal-clear vision on those cloudy days.
  • Customization Options: Everyone has a unique style, and the future of the Pinlock system recognizes this. From personalized designs and colors to interchangeable lenses, you’ll have the freedom to customize your Pinlock visor to match your personality and motorcycle.

The Pinlock system has already revolutionized the way we see the road, and these future innovations are just the beginning. Whether you’re a casual rider or a seasoned motorcyclist, get ready to experience a whole new level of performance, safety, and style with the Pinlock system.


Q: What is the Pinlock system?
A: The Pinlock system is a revolutionary anti-fog technology designed to ensure clear vision while wearing a helmet. It consists of a Pinlock insert that is installed on the helmet visor, creating a double-pane system that minimizes fogging.

Q: How does the Pinlock system work?
A: The Pinlock system works by creating a sealed air space between the helmet visor and the Pinlock insert. This space acts as a thermal barrier, preventing condensation and fog from forming on the visor. The Pinlock insert is made of a moisture-absorbing material that absorbs any excess moisture to maintain visibility.

Q: Why is fogging a problem with helmet visors?
A: Fogging is a common issue with helmet visors, especially in changing weather conditions or during physical exertion. It can significantly impair visibility, making it dangerous for riders on the road. The Pinlock system effectively addresses this problem, ensuring an unobstructed view at all times.

Q: How easy is it to install the Pinlock system on a helmet?
A: Installing the Pinlock system is a straightforward process. First, ensure that your helmet is Pinlock-ready, meaning it has the necessary pins or pins-ready visor. Then, simply align the Pinlock insert with the pins on the visor, press it firmly into place, and it’s good to go!

Q: Can the Pinlock system be used with any type of helmet?
A: While not all helmets are Pinlock-compatible, many manufacturers offer Pinlock-ready helmets or provide Pinlock visors as an accessory. It’s always best to consult the helmet manufacturer or retailer to ensure compatibility with the Pinlock system.

Q: Is the Pinlock system effective in all weather conditions?
A: Yes, the Pinlock system is designed to work in various weather conditions. Whether you’re riding in cold or humid weather, the Pinlock insert will help keep your visor clear and fog-free, ensuring optimal vision and safety.

Q: How often should I replace the Pinlock insert?
A: The lifespan of a Pinlock insert depends on several factors, such as usage and maintenance. However, it is recommended to replace the Pinlock insert every 1-2 years to ensure maximum effectiveness. If you notice signs of wear or decreased performance, such as reduced clarity, it’s time to replace it.

Q: Can the Pinlock system be cleaned?
A: Yes, the Pinlock insert can be cleaned. To clean it, remove it from the helmet visor, gently wash it with warm water and mild soap, and rinse thoroughly. Allow it to dry completely before reinstallation. Avoid using abrasive materials or chemicals that may damage the Pinlock insert.

Q: Does the Pinlock system add any weight or bulk to the helmet?
A: The Pinlock insert is designed to be lightweight and thin, so it does not significantly add weight or bulk to the helmet. It seamlessly integrates into the visor system, providing you with enhanced visibility without compromising comfort or style.

Q: Are there any other benefits of using the Pinlock system?
A: Apart from its anti-fog properties, the Pinlock system offers additional benefits. It reduces the need for constant visor ventilation adjustments and prevents the accumulation of dust, debris, and bugs on the helmet visor. Overall, it provides a safer, more enjoyable riding experience.

Key Takeaways

In conclusion, the Pinlock system truly unlocks the mystery behind foggy visors, providing riders with an innovative solution that enhances safety and comfort on the road. By implementing advanced technology and years of research, manufacturers have successfully developed a reliable anti-fogging system that is both effective and easy to use.

Whether you are a seasoned rider or a new enthusiast, investing in a Pinlock-equipped helmet is undoubtedly a game-changer. No longer will fogged-up visors hinder your vision, jeopardizing your safety and riding experience. With the Pinlock system, you can confidently hit the road, knowing that your vision will remain clear, regardless of the weather conditions.

From its simple installation process to its unparalleled performance, the Pinlock system is bound to impress even the most skeptical of riders. Its seamless integration with various helmet models and its compatibility with different visor types make it a versatile and highly sought-after accessory.

Remember, taking care of your safety on the road should always be a priority. Don’t let foggy visors compromise your ability to ride safely. Embrace the Pinlock system and unlock a world of clear vision and improved riding experience.

So, next time you suit up for your thrilling ride, make sure to equip yourself with the incredible Pinlock system. Ride confidently, ride comfortably, and enjoy the journey like never before. Happy riding!

